Abstract |
|
In a communication system spectrum band has a crucial role. Spectrum band can efficiently use by cognitive radio because of its ability to sense surrounding environment. Cognitive radio sense vacant holes or unoccupied spectrum band by detecting the primary users' presence or absence in the spectrum. Also, prevent interference between signals. Using more than one cognitive radio in the detection process will increase the efficiency of spectrum usage. Conventional cooperative spectrum sensing detects signal for high SNR value but using machine learning techniques detection of signal occur under low SNR also increase efficiency and detection performance. The aim of is to classify signal and noise using Machine learning method for Cognitive Radio. Used machine learning technique for cooperative spectrum sensing method in cognitive radio based on the fuzzy membership functions and Fusion center (FC). At Fusion Center information combines from each the secondary users and using some fuzzy rules such as algebraic product, algebraic sum gives a final decision about the absence/presence of a primary user. Proposed System designed using multiple parameters. The Fuzzy Logic system gives much better results compared to the Referred system also Detection of signal occurs at low SNR condition. |
